@junebuggena how many bunnies did you hatch so far & get put to freezer camp ? Just wondering how the investment is going so far....how often do you cook rabbit, what recipes do you like best ?
My does are older and the litter size is starting to reflect that. We sent 10 to the freezer in November. I only have one left. We have it about once a week, and I use it just like I would chicken. I cut 6 of them into pieces, and left 4 whole for roasting. I am raising them on pasture, so it takes longer for them to reach processing size, but it's worth it to see those little ones frolicing and mowing the yards for me.
Our favorite recipe is in the crock pot with a jar of chile verde salsa, then serve over rice. Leftovers can be used later in the week as tacos or sloppy joes. It's a denser protein than chicken, so it's more filling.
